I'm planning to build my own NAS for use as a Plex server and data storage solution. I have been searching for different off-site backup solutions, and out of curiosity, I started wondering how Linus Media Group handles its off-site backup. I found two videos from Linus Tech Tips that discuss this topic. In the second video, Linus strongly suggests that tape storage might be their solution (though in the first video, Linus dismisses tape storage as having too high upfront cost). They don't confirm this in the video, and I cannot remember any instances after these videos where they would have confirmed this. So can anyone confirm whether tape storage is their official off-site backup solution?

Campaign link: http://newoffice.linustechtips.com We've had an amazing couple of years here at Linus Media Group, and we can't wait to see what the future holds! Especially with your help... REWARDS TRACKER LINKS $12,000 campaign reward link: http://bit.ly/1uNcqdH CROWD FUNDING Q&A FROM NOV. 21 WAN SHOW Q: Why don’t you have lower contribution tiers like $1 A: Right now everything is going through PayPal and for very small transactions the proportion of the payment that they take for their cut is higher, so rather than encouraging the members of our community who can afford it least to give a bunch of their money to PayPal we would rather they keep it for themselves. Q: Your stretch targets are ridiculous. Why are they so high A: You’re right, they were much higher than they should have been initially, and a big part of the reason for that is we weren’t sure how much momentum this campaign would have and we didn’t want to trap ourselves by putting ourselves in a situation where we had to do every stretch target in a span of a week. Now that we can see how things are tracking we have rearranged the stretch targets to make them much more attainable, but spread them out enough that we won’t be doing everything at once throughout the campaign. Q: Aren’t you guys a business? Why aren’t you seeking investment or taking out a loan A: Yes we are a business, but those of you savvy enough to figure out these types of business strategies should also be savvy enough to know that moving into a much larger space is going to cost a LOT more than $50,000 - our goal for the campaign - even in the short term. We are exploring every avenue necessary to grow and keep delivering the best content we can regardless of how much we raise during this campaign Q: Then why are you asking us for money at all? A: Because some of you WANT to help us in this way. To those people we send our heartfelt gratitude, and to everyone else, we still send our heartfelt gratitude, because EVERY contribution - even one view on a video - counts. The thing to realize here is we aren’t holding anything hostage if we don’t hit the campaign goal. Everything will go towards doing our best to keep doing what we’re doing. If you like that, great. If you don’t, then don’t contribute. Q: Why don’t you have any cool physical rewards A: This actually ties into the last one. We’re asking for money so that we can move into a bigger space, hire more people, and make better content, NOT so we can sell you a bunch of stickers, T-shirts, and hats. If you want to contribute to Linus Media Group by buying a T-shirt, then go buy a T-shirt…. We have a variety of styles on both of our web shops. The usual complaint about the web stores is “omg the shipping is so expensive” to which I’d reply “Then I guess you figured out why physical merchandise would basically kill any possibility of using the funding from this campaign to fund a move. That cost doesn’t go away because it’s a special crowd-funding T-shirt. So out of that $25 reward tier, we’ll STILL be paying $8 per T-shirt and up to $13 or MORE for International shipping. Q: I don’t want to contribute because investing in a company without any ROI is stupid. I want to be a stakeholder. A: We don’t want stakeholders, and I suspect neither do the people who ARE contributing to our new office expansion - the closet thing we have to direct backers for our company! If we had stakeholders all of a sudden there might be pressure to start paying dividends and being accountable for the kind of content we’re making to some random that the community has never met. People are contributing because they want ME in charge without some shadow lurking over my shoulder telling me what to do.

What is this? As you may or may not have heard, we are moving to a new office very very soon! This is extremely exciting for all of us, as it means that we will have the space to put together amazing sets for our current shows as well as any shows that may come in the future. It also gives us the space to pick up some new team members here at LMG, something that we are pretty much out of in our current office... Over the next month and a bit, we will be running a crowdfunding campaign through the forum to help supplement our moving expenses and renovation costs. There will be some very cool contributor rewards and quite a few awesome stretch goals (more info on those soon :D). Now, many moons ago when the forum was but a wee discussion board, we promised that we would never add a top banner ad to our site. We know that many of you guys appreciate that, and we never plan to accept payment for a top banner spot on our forum. However, with your approval, we would love to be able to advertise our own crowdfunding campaign in the top banner spot. Obviously our dedicated community members will find out about the campaign either way, but casual visitors might not see it unless it is prominently displayed in a spot like the top banner. So please answer the poll and leave your thoughts down below. Can we add a top banner for our own campaign? Would we be going against our word to do so even though it's for our own campaign with no third party involved? Rest assured, we won't be adding a top banner ad for our crowdfunding campaign unless there is an immensely positive response to this poll. Thanks everyone! -Nick
